The Oregon State University academic prestige as a Tier 1 research institution attracts thousands of applicants across its Corvallis and Bend campus locations every year. International candidates can access generous international funding opportunities, which include tuition assistance, partial coverage, and full fee exemption options. Furthermore, selected scholarship packages offer a reliable living allowance, stipend, housing allowance, meal plan, and mandatory health insurance support.

Major funding tracks include the highly competitive Provost Scholarship, the Finley Academic Excellence Award, and the Diversity Achievement Scholarship. Additionally, unique programmes such as the International Cultural Service Program (ICSP) blend financial aid with cultural exchange by engaging students in community outreach and requiring 66-80 hours of service annually. All applicants manage their applications through the OSU ScholarDollars portal, a central scholarship database that distributes merit-based funding, providing immense financial relief against rising study abroad costs through official educational grants and higher education financing.

The pathway to securing funding starts with submitting an Oregon State University general admissions application using the Common App or the direct OSU portal. Once admitted, students receive an ONID student account creation prompt and a unique 93-number student ID verification code.

Using these credentials, candidates log inΒ to the OSU ScholarDollars database system to access hundreds of internal funding opportunities. The next step involves completing the general scholarship profile, which uses a matching algorithm to pair students with eligible awards. Applicants must submit specific supplemental scholarship applications well before strict deadlines andΒ regularly track application status updates, monitor award notifications, and check for email updates and confirmation receipts.

Receiving an acceptance letter allows students to initiate the F1 student visa application by obtaining the official form I-20 issuance and paying the required SEVIS fee payment. Candidates must then submit the online DS-160 visa interview form and schedule an appointment at the nearest United States embassy or consulate while presenting up-to-date financial documentation.

During their studies, international scholars can utilise on-campus employment authorisation to work up to 20 hours per week during academic terms. Practical training opportunities include Curricular Practical Training (CPT) and post-graduation Optional Practical Training (OPT), which features a 24-month STEM extension for eligible graduates. The university’s career services department assists students in finding internships, facilitating job placement, and accessing broader post-graduation employment opportunities.

What is the minimum GPA required for OSU international scholarships?

Most automatic consideration merit scholarships at Oregon State University require a minimum cumulative GPA of 3.00 on a 4.00 scale. Higher-tier awards, such as the Finley Academic Excellence Scholarship or Summit Award, typically require a GPA of 3.50 to 3.90 or higher.

Is IELTS or TOEFL mandatory for admission and scholarship eligibility at OSU?

Proof of English proficiency is mandatory for non-native English speakers. OSU accepts IELTS Academic, TOEFL iBT, and the Duolingo English Test (DET). English test waivers are available for students who completed their previous education in English-speaking nations or qualifying institutions.

How do I apply for scholarships using the OSU ScholarDollars system?

You must first apply for undergraduate or graduate admission to Oregon State University. After receiving your student ID and setting up your ONID account, log into the OSU ScholarDollars portal, fill out the general profile, and submit individual applications for matched scholarship opportunities before the deadline.
